10 Peaks in 10 Weeks
Purchase this book at Amazon.comThis book is a reprint of material that appeared in the Post Register’s “Let’s Go!” section over a 10-week period from late August through October of 1995. The project was to take readers to the 10 highest points in the newspaper’s 10-county circulation area. We thought it would be fun to find and climb, hike or pedal to the top of all these high points. If turned out to be a very enjoyable adventure. These 10 counties not only have some of the state’s best wild country, but some of the nation’s best. In the course of doing this project we discovered some wonderful sights, beautiful country and had many interesting experiences. This booklet also includes a brief mention of 21 other high spots worth trying. I hope this project will encourage you to get out and enjoy some of the region’s great backcountry.

Mayhem on the Middle Fork
Purchase this book at Amazon.comJon Boling sang as he steered his cataraft down the Middle Fork of the Salmon River on June 3. His little ditty parodied the tune of an old Toys-R-Us jingle: "I don't want to grow up; I'm a Middle Fork kid!" He was giddy.These were the moments he lived for -- a beautiful river, a cooler full of good beer, the company of friends.Life doesn't get any better. As a Southerner who migrated west in pursuit of a life lived to the fullest, Boling relished the moment. But less than two hours into a five-day trip, Boling's boat flipped in a rapid. His hulking frame was no match for the icy waters. His heart gave out. Boling was 34 years old. This is the story of his final voyage.
